Mathias: offsetHeight nicht DOM-kompatibel

Hallo,

schon wieder ein Problem ...

Um die Höhe eines DIVs festzustellen verwende ich [Objekt].offsetHeight. Das funktioniert auch im MSIE 5 und NN 6. Opera 5.11 weigert sich.
(Das DIV hat keine feste Breite oder Höhe.)

Ich habe die Eigenschaft nicht im W3C-DOM gefunden. Auch im M$-Tutorial ist angegeben, dass keine W3C-Definition zu Grunde liegt. Aber sollten sich M$ und Netscape an dieser Stelle ZUFÄLLIG getroffen haben? Das glaub ich einfach nicht ,-)

Kenn jemand mir da weiterhelfen?

  1. Moin

    offsetHeight

    Ich habe die Eigenschaft nicht im W3C-DOM gefunden.

    Wenn ich es richtig verstanden habe, repräsentiert DOM nur das Dokument an sich, nicht eine (von vielen möglichen) Arten der Darstellung. "Wenn offsetHeight dann müsste auch ein loundnessLow oder vergleichbares aufgenommen werden" könnte die Gegenargumentation lauten.

    Sinnvoll finde ich diese Trennung nicht, denn ein Standard ist doch immer was nützliches :-)

    Viele Grüße

    Swen

    1. Hallo,

      wenn DOM nur das Domument an sich repräsentatiert, wo einigt man sich dann über eben solche Properties wie offsetWidth?

      Soweit ich gelesen haben hat Netscape (oder besser: das Mozilla-Team) diese Eigenschaft ebenso wie "innerHTML" von Microsoft kopiert, weil man annimmt, dass sie irgendwann in irgendeinen  Standard aufgenommen werden. Das glaub ich einfach nicht.

      m.

      1. Moin

        wenn DOM nur das Domument an sich repräsentatiert, wo einigt man sich dann über eben solche Properties wie offsetWidth?

        Soweit ich gelesen haben hat Netscape (oder besser: das Mozilla-Team)

        Oder doch Netcape? Würde mich (aus vielleicht naiver Außensicht) wundern, wenn Mozilla beim W3C viel zu sagen hätte.

        diese Eigenschaft ebenso wie "innerHTML" von Microsoft kopiert, weil man annimmt, dass sie irgendwann in irgendeinen  Standard aufgenommen werden. Das glaub ich einfach nicht.

        Dieser Thread in einer Mailingliste des W3C http://lists.w3.org/Archives/Public/www-dom/2001JanMar/0071.html mag vielleicht ein wenig weiterhelfen.

        Viele Grüße

        Swen